The Ramnagar fort away from Varanasi 14 km.The fort at Ramnagar houses a museum displaying the Royal collected works which includes vintage cars, Royal palkies, an armoury of swords and old guns, ivory work and antique clock. The Durga Temple and Chhinnamastika Temple are also positioned at Ramnagar.
This 17th century fort which is 16 km from railway station and positioned crosswise the Ganges, is the palace of the former Maharaja of Benares. Of individual notice here are the Durbar Hall (public audience room) and museum which houses an traditional collected works of palanquins, arms, elephant saddles, costumes.
